Legend Oil & Gas, Ltd. Announces New Chief Financial Officer

July 7, 2014

 Legend Oil and Gas, Ltd. is pleased to announce the appointment of Warren S. Binderman, CPA, as its Executive Vice President, Chief Financial Officer, and Principal Accounting Officer. 

Mr. Binderman, 50, has over 25 years accounting, finance and business experience to add value to Legend. He has worked for National firms (Big 4 and Top 20) as both an auditor and transaction services/due diligence Director and audit Partner. Concurrent with his position at Legend, Mr. Binderman runs Binderman Group, LLC, a boutique accounting, auditing and consulting firm. 

He graduated with a B.S. in Business and Management, concentrating in accounting, from the University of Maryland, magna cum laude, in 1990. He is a CPA in Georgia and Maryland, and is a member of the American Institute of CPAs, and has been since 1991.
